Tree relocation services involve carefully transplanting mature or large trees from one location to another. This process typically includes assessing the health and stability of the tree, preparing the new site to ensure proper growth, and using specialized equipment to safely lift and transport the tree without causing damage. Skilled contractors focus on maintaining the tree’s root system and overall integrity throughout the move, helping to ensure the tree’s survival in its new setting. This service is often chosen by homeowners or property managers looking to preserve existing landscape features or adapt their outdoor space for new construction or redesign projects.

Relocation of trees can help solve several common property challenges. For instance, when construction or landscaping projects threaten to damage or remove valuable mature trees, moving them can preserve these natural features. It’s also useful for homeowners who want to keep a favorite tree that is located in a less ideal spot, such as too close to a future building site, utility lines, or areas prone to flooding. Additionally, tree relocation can address issues related to property aesthetics or environmental concerns, allowing property owners to maintain shade, privacy, or landscape continuity without sacrificing mature greenery.

This service is frequently used on residential properties, especially those with established gardens or large yards that feature prominent trees. It’s also common on commercial properties, parks, and community spaces where mature trees contribute to the overall landscape design. Homeowners planning renovations or additions might consider tree relocation to avoid removing valuable trees, while property developers may use it to enhance the appeal of new developments. In many cases, trees that are too close to structures, utility lines, or property boundaries are relocated to safer, more suitable locations to optimize the use of outdoor space.

The overview below groups typical Tree Relocation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Knoxville, TN.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Tree Relocations - Typically, these jobs cost between $250 and $600 for many smaller or routine tree moves. Many projects fall into this range when relocating young or small trees within the same property. Larger or more complex jobs can exceed this range but are less common.

Medium-Scale Tree Moving - For medium-sized trees or moderate relocation distances, local contractors usually charge between $600 and $1,500. These projects often involve trees that are 10 to 20 feet tall and require moderate equipment and planning.

Large Tree Relocations - Moving large or mature trees, especially those over 20 feet tall, can cost from $1,500 to $3,500 or more. Many of these projects involve significant planning, specialized equipment, and careful handling, making them less frequent but more costly.

Full Tree Replacement - When a tree cannot be relocated and needs to be replaced, costs for purchasing and planting new trees typically range from $100 to $1,000 or higher, depending on species and size. This option is common when relocation isn't feasible or cost-effective for larger specimens.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is involved in relocating a tree? Tree relocation typically includes assessing the tree's health and size, preparing the new site, and carefully transplanting the tree to minimize stress and ensure survival.

Are there specific types of trees that can be relocated? Most mature trees can be relocated, but the success depends on the species, size, and health of the tree, as well as the skill of the local contractors handling the job.

How do local contractors prepare for a tree relocation? Contractors usually evaluate the tree and site conditions, plan the excavation process, and select appropriate equipment to safely move the tree without damaging it.

What should be considered when choosing a tree relocation service? It’s important to find experienced local service providers with a track record of successful tree transplants and the proper equipment for the job.

Can tree relocation help improve landscape design? Yes, relocating trees can enhance landscape aesthetics, provide shade, and help integrate mature trees into new or existing outdoor spaces effectively.
